Maja Bašit
Maja Bašit is a mountain in Opština Sjenica, Zlatibor District, Central Serbia and has an elevation of 1,333 metres. Maja Bašit is situated nearby to the village Boroštica, as well as near the locality Ravnište.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 1,333 metres

Boroštica
Village
Boroštica is a village in the municipality of Tutin,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 379 people. Boroštica is one of three Albanian villages in the Pešter region.
Suvi Do
Village
Suvi Do is a village in the municipality of Tutin, Serbia. According to the 2002 census, the village has a population of 401 people. Suvi Do is situated 3 km southeast of Maja Bašit.
Ugao
Village
Ugao is a village located in the municipality of Sjenica, southwestern Serbia. According to the 2011 census, the village has a population of 545 inhabitants. Ugao is situated 3 km west of Maja Bašit.
